Elite Theatre

The Elite Theatre was opened in 1906 and was operated by William H. Marple. In May 1909 it was sold to new operators. It had closed by 1915.

This theater was located in the Richland Block, a large and ornate three story brick commercial block with metal bay windows. It was built sometime between August 1886 and November 1887, since it only appears on the later map. In 1931, the western half of the building was demolished to construct a large Montgomery Ward on the corner. That is apparently still there under a criminally ugly ‘70s remodel. The rest of the building, comprising 409 and 411, was still there in 1950, but was likely demolished by the '70s.
